Transaction ab4e24f8eda64f17c2ee877efce23ac9b4e4eac46e267efbb07c564054d7a32a

1 Input
2 Outputs
  • ab4e24f8eda64f17c2ee877efce23ac9b4e4eac46e267efbb07c564054d7a32a:0
  • value  538000
    address  3FRR5uF9neq1AjDWRZ3fHjPdwL5cbgBDUm
  • ab4e24f8eda64f17c2ee877efce23ac9b4e4eac46e267efbb07c564054d7a32a:1
  • value  26339373
    address  1Lg1TRBnSot4T9MmhbEFKWkRvFyM5vpHgC